  2. Hi Dougx. Have you received the modded BIOS from Klem with the correct Option ROM or Hybrid ROM with the GOP driver, or whatever mod Klem has made? I'm in the same journey but on an ASUS G73SW laptop. I'm currently in the investigation phase, where I'm stuck with the idea that probably I will need to mod my BIOS adding the legacy vbios of GTX 780m along with a GOP section inside CSMCORE module. Still investigating if that's the correct path, since there are several sizes of vbios for GTX 780m and I'm going with the DELL vbios (my GTX 780m card was manufactured by DELL). That vbios sizes around 162KB, I think it's not the correct size to put into CSMCORE module (as an EFI rom). In contrary, the Alienware vbios sizes around 89KB and that's one I can add into CSMCORE module (as an EFI rom). If case the answer is yes, can you share the modded BIOS? Thanks in advance.
